How to use Free YouTube Download

Step 1. Download Free YouTube Download

Step 2. Launch Free YouTube Download

Save FLV to AVI: launch the program

Follow Start > All Programs > DVDVideoSoft > Programs > Free YouTube Download or click the DVDVideoSoft Free Studio icon on the desktop.

The interface is very simple and self explaining. There is a field for YouTube Video links, a field for an output path, and the Download button.

Step 3. Add YouTube Video Links

Save FLV to AVI: add YouTube video links

Use your Internet browser to select and copy YouTube link you want to download .

Click the Paste button and wait a few seconds while the program is detecting YouTube video.

Step 4. Add Playlists, Video Responses, Channels and Users' Favourites

Save FLV to AVI: save a list of YouTube links

It's easy to download the whole playlist, for instance, this Cats playlist.

Just follow Step 3: copy YouTube playlist link and paste it to the program.

The program will detect videos at this link. In the input field you'll see the total amount of detected clips. Click the Videos... button to mark which of clips you want to download. Click OK.

In the same way you can download channels, users' favourites or video responses from YouTube.

Step 5. Select Output Options

Save FLV to AVI: select output folder

Click the Browse... button and choose the location where you would like to save your downloaded video files from YouTube. Click Ok.

Save FLV to AVI: click Output Name... to form the pattern of the output file name

By default the output file name is the same as YouTube video title is. If you want to change it click the Output Name... button. A new window will be opened.

There are some parameters in it (Name Prefix, Postfix and others) which you can set as you like.

In the bottom of this window you can see the pattern of the output file name. It's formed according to the current options.

Note: the pattern is the same for all output files during one session, it's not allowed to set the unique pattern for each file.

Step 6. Select Output Format Preset

Save FLV to AVI: select output format preset

In the list of Presets select one of the available pre-configured presets.

You can specify the output video file format as FLV, AVI or MP4.

Step 7. Setting Options (Optional)

Save FLV to AVI: setting options

There are some options you can set as you like.

Tick the "Auto-paste URLs from the Clipboard" parameter and all YouTube links from the Clipboard will be detected and added to the program automatically.

In the Options window you can also change the language or set "Turn off computer, if the process was finished successfully".

Save FLV to AVI: setting options

Tick "Use proxy server" option to use a proxy server. Then enter Address and Port.

You can find information about proxy Address and Port in your browser settings.

Internet Explorer users go to Tools->Internet Options->Connections tab->LAN Settings...

Firefox users go to Tools->Options->Network tab->Settings...

You can also contact your network administrator for this information.

Step 8. Download Video

Save FLV to AVI: download video from YouTube

When you are ready, click the Download button along the bottom of the interface and wait just a few seconds or several minutes max (depending on your internet connection speed).

Now the YouTube video is on your computer.

Remember: If you selected Option "Turn off computer, if the process was finished successfully", your computer will be turned off when the process is completed.
